Wildlife Conservation Network (WCN)

WCN connects donors with field-based conservationists working to protect endangered species. They support projects for elephants, lions, cheetahs, and many more across Africa, Asia, and Latin America. WCN ensures 100% of designated donations go directly to the chosen project.

Impact: Supports over 30 species-focused programs with measurable conservation outcomes.

International Rhino Foundation

Working across Africa and Asia, this foundation funds rhino protection, habitat restoration, anti-poaching patrols, and local community development. They also run emergency rescue and rehab for injured rhinos.

Impact: Over 30 years of rhino conservation, with major success in Zimbabwe and Indonesia.

Cheetah Conservation Fund (CCF)

Based in Namibia, CCF is a global leader in cheetah conservation, combining scientific research with education, farmer training, and livestock protection programs.

Impact: Reduced human-cheetah conflict and helped stabilize the cheetah population in key regions.

Panthera

Panthera focuses on the conservation of the world’s wild cats, including leopards, lions, tigers, and jaguars. They work with governments and communities to create safe corridors and crack down on wildlife trafficking.

Impact: Established key wildlife corridors and trained anti-poaching units across multiple continents.

🇿🇦 Local Conservation Champions in South Africa: Focus on Limpopo & Hoedspruit

If you want to give where the wildlife lives, these local NGOs in Limpopo Province—particularly around Hoedspruit—offer exceptional transparency and boots-on-the-ground impact.

Hoedspruit Animal Outreach (HALO)

HALO works with rural communities to provide veterinary care for domestic animals, reducing disease transmission to wildlife and preventing overpopulation.

Why Donate: Strengthens both human and animal health in conservation-sensitive areas.

SanWild Wildlife Sanctuary

This sanctuary provides lifelong care for animals that cannot be released and also conducts anti-poaching patrols in their protected reserve. They are vocal advocates against trophy hunting.

Why Donate: Your support helps protect an entire ecosystem and fund anti-poaching rangers.

Elephants Alive

A 25-year-strong organization based near Hoedspruit, Elephants Alive studies elephant behavior, maintains habitat health, collars over 2,000 elephants, and trains community anti-poaching coalitions

Why Donate: Funds go directly to tracking elephants, habitat restoration, and community-beehive projects to reduce conflict .

Ingwe Research Programme

The Ingwe Research Programme is a citizen science-powered leopard monitoring initiative. Here’s what your donation supports:

  • Field equipment: Funds goes toward camera traps, batteries, and AI tools that identify individual leopards from thousands of images.

  • Operational costs: Sustains camera-trap management across wide conservation landscapes, including reserves and farms.
